    I was wondering what chips people prefer. Specifically it would be for a pretty much stock (cai and exhaust only) 95 v6. and i'm trying to figure out which one i should go with.

    i wouldn't chip the car either with only those two mods. you'll be disappointed in your gains if you do it now. you'll always want to get it reprogrammed if you ever mod any further.

    before you buy a chip you should get an 8.8" rear with some 3.73, 4.10's, etc. and some under drive pulleys. then the chip would at least calibrate your speedo.

    I was referring to SCT- Superchip Custom Tuning... it is a seperate division of Superchip with Jerry, the brain beind Fordchip's work, and a few other experts. Don't confuse SCT with "Superchips"

    Fordchip programming=SCT programming. Just for the record.
